exponenta event banner

getOctaveBandwidth

Полоса пропускания в числе октав

Описание

пример

N = getOctaveBandwidth(npFilter) возвращает ширину полосы частот пикового фильтра пробки, измеренную в числе октав.

Примеры

свернуть все

Создать dsp.NotchPeakFilter в конфигурации по умолчанию.

np = dsp.NotchPeakFilter
np = 
  dsp.NotchPeakFilter with properties:

      Specification: 'Bandwidth and center frequency'
          Bandwidth: 2205
    CenterFrequency: 11025
         SampleRate: 44100

Определите октавную полосу пропускания фильтра с помощью getOctaveBandwidth функция.

getOctaveBandwidth(np)
ans = 0.2881

Визуализация отклика фильтра с помощью fvtool.

fvtool(np)

Figure Filter Visualization Tool - Magnitude Response (dB) contains an axes and other objects of type uitoolbar, uimenu. The axes with title Magnitude Response (dB) contains an object of type line.

Входные аргументы

свернуть все

Пиковый фильтр пробки, ширина полосы пропускания которого измеряется в октавах, указанный как dsp.NotchPeakFilter объект.

Выходные аргументы

свернуть все

Ширина полосы пропускания фильтра, измеренная в количестве октав, возвращается в виде скаляра.

Типы данных: double

См. также

Функции

Объекты

Представлен в R2014a